§ 47-10-106 — Construction and application

Tennessee·Title 47

This chapter must be construed and applied to:

(1)Facilitate electronic transactions consistent with other applicable law;
(2)Be consistent with reasonable practices concerning electronic transactions and with the continued expansion of those practices; and (3) Effectuate its general purpose to make uniform the law with respect to the subject of this chapter among states enacting it.
